As is habit, Italian brand Nuove Forme looked back in the creation of the 'Bolo' plate — in this case, to the 1970s and a very specific type of organic-style ceramics. Featuring hand-carved detailing in a distinct geometric pattern, the plate is also defined by the application of a complementary enamel that has produced a texture filled with bubbles and cracks, as well as a cold bituminous patina.
